Publisher Description

Biodegradation and Detoxification of Micropollutants in Industrial Wastewater summarizes the occurrence and source of micropollutants through various industrial wastewaters. It covers the type of micropollutants, their effects, and emerging detection and treatment methods. The book has 11 chapters, and throughout each chapter, it presents the fate and effects of micropollutants, quantitative and qualitative analysis of micropollutants in industrial wastewaters, and treatment of micropollutants through conventional and advanced wastewater treatment technologies.



- Presents detailed information on the micropollutants of industrial wastewaters and their origins

- Assesses the toxic effect these micropollutants have on living organisms

- Evaluates emerging treatment technologies for the removal of micropollutants

- Includes molecular biology, nanotechnology and microbiology approaches for the management of micropollutants in industrial wastewaters
